iceprog: Add option that set QE=1 bit in SR2
This is useful when testing litex SoC that rely on that bit being set The setting is non-volatile so it only needs to be done once in case you happen to have used a flash chip that's not by default QE=1 (This has been designed for winbond flash. Others might use different bit ...) Signed-off-by: Sylvain Munaut <tnt@246tNt.com>
